Removable liftgate flipper glass with detachable hinge

A detachable hinge assembly configured to rotatably couple a window assembly to a vehicle body includes a support hinge member configured to couple to the vehicle body and including a hinge pin, and a window hinge member having a main body configured to couple to the window assembly, and one or more knuckles configured to removably receive the hinge pin. A cover is rotatably coupled to the window hinge member and includes a pin retaining arm. The cover is configured to move between a closed position where the pin retaining arm is positioned to retain the hinge pin within the one or more knuckles, and an open position where the pin retaining arm is positioned to allow the hinge pin to be removed from the one or more knuckles.

Detachable and Reversible Cooler Lid Hinge Assembly

The invention consists of a novel cooler hinge construction that allows for the cooler's lid to be removed and reattached easily. One benefit of such an assembly is that either side of the lid may be used facing upwards, depending on what the user is doing at the time. The lid is attached to the hinge by a clamp assembly that pinches the lid and holds it in place. The jaws of the clamp are housed within identical grooves on the top and bottom of the lid, allowing the lid to be pulled out of the clamp when the cooler is open and to be subsequently reattached by sliding the lid back into the clamp. This functionality allows for the lid to be removed and reattached easily, but also holds it securely in place when the cooler is closed because the lid is unable to move laterally. The clamp also serves as a controlled fail point for the invention, allowing the lid to break away before the hinge or clamp are damaged.

Furniture hinge

The invention relates to a furniture hinge for the articulated securing of a furniture door, leaf or similar to a furniture body, in particular to a frame of a furniture body, comprising a mounting plate for securing the furniture hinge to the furniture body and a hinge body for securing the furniture hinge to the furniture door, leaf or similar, wherein a pivotally mounted hinge arm is associated with the hinge body and wherein the hinge arm can be secured to the mounting plate directly or via at least one connection element secured to the hinge arm. In addition, the hinge arm can be secured to the mounting plate indirectly or directly via a connection system that can be closed without tools. The furniture hinge permits a quick and secure mounting of a furniture door, leaf or similar to a furniture body.

Simply fitted furniture hinge

The invention relates to a furniture hinge having a mounting body and a hinge body with a hinge arm for fastening, in a hinged manner, a furniture door or the like to a furniture carcass. According to the invention, at least one section of the hinge arm or of a component connected to the hinge arm has at least one guide section which interacts with a sliding guide on the mounting body in such a manner that the hinge arm or the component connected to the hinge arm is mounted displaceably in the sliding guide along an installation direction and is retained transversely to the installation direction and that a movement of the hinge arm against the installation direction can be blocked when an installation position is reached. The invention further relates to an associated method for mounting a furniture door in a hinged manner. The furniture hinge and the method permit the installation of a furniture door, flap or the like to a furniture carcass in a fast and reliable fashion.

MAINFRAME DOOR WITH INTEGRATED EARTHQUAKE HARDWARE AND REVERSIBLE SWING

A mainframe door assembly for a frame is provided. The mainframe door assembly includes a door having opposed first and second sides and first and second mount assemblies. The first and second mount assemblies are configured to mount the first and second sides of the door to the frame, respectively, such that the door can occupy and move between an installed position and a loading position. In the installed position, the door is flush with the frame. In the loading position, the first mount assemblies support and the second mount assemblies permit a swinging of the door about the first side or the second mount assemblies support and the first mount assemblies permit a swinging of the door about the second side.

TELECOMMUNICATIONS ENCLOSURE WITH A SEPARATE MOUNTABLE HINGE

The present disclosure relates to a telecommunications enclosures that can be customizable to include a hinge. That is, a separate hinge may be utilized as an add-on feature for telecommunications enclosures. The hinge can be attached to at least two different sides of an enclosure or may not be utilized at all. Such a configuration allows for flexibility of a variety of designs for a telecommunications enclosure. The hinge can be mountable to interfaces of first and second housing pieces of an enclosure. The hinge can have rotational features and/or translational features for pivoting first and second housing pieces of an enclosure between first and second positions.

Quick turn latch mechanism

A latch mechanism having a quick turn and release feature where the latch mechanism comprises a first body member having at least one actuation device. A second body member is coupled to the first body member and includes at least one aperture and pin receiving channel formed therein. A pin element is coupled to the second body member and includes a first pin portion and a second pin portion. The first pin portion and the second pin portion are respectively arranged to extend axially within the pin receiving channel of the second body member such that an upward rotation of the actuation device in a counterclockwise direction releasably disengages the pin element from a shaft of one or more hinges of the door assembly to allow an operator to exit an operator cab of the work vehicle.
